Caligari

Now this was an awesome movie. It had a twist at the end and everything, but I am not going to ruin it for people who havent seen it yet. I love horror/thrillers and to see where they originated from was awesome. I have seen Nosferatu before and enjoy that emensley.

This film showed me where Tim Burton got some ideas for his sets in "Corpse Bride". The zany backdrops and exagerated make up was nearly too much... I still loved it though. It started slow and was one of those movies where it started as a "I remember when..." then the movie plays off of that persons memory. Usually i'd be all like "augh...not THIS again...", but seeing as it was probably the first of it's kind I sat back and enjoyed it.

Rating: 8/10
